Graduated in Electrical Engineering at the University of Araraquara (UNIARA) in 2015, MSc in Electrical Engineering at the University of São Paulo (USP) in 2018, and Electrical and Electronics Technician at the Industrial Learning Service - SENAI Henrique Lupo, 2009. As a researcher of the Center for the Development of Functional Materials (CDMF) has developed multifunctional materials through chemical and physical deposition processes for application in piezoelectric nanogenerators, gas sensors, varistors, and solar cells. Currently conducts scientific research on sensors and biosensors for application in laboratory diagnosis and develops electron beam system for irradiation of semiconductor materials. Member of the CDMF/FAPESP research group and Ph.D. student in the Telecommunications and Optics group at the University of São Paulo - USP/São Carlos - Brazil.
